How are rail clips fixed to the rails?
Rail clips are fixed to rails through two primary methods: bolting or welding. For bolted systems, clips are secured to the track structure with bolts, nuts, and washers that are tightened to hold the rail in place. Welded clips have their base plate fused to the supporting structure using a fillet weld.
Bolted clips
- Placement: The clip body is positioned over the rail, and its bottom flange rests on the rail's bottom surface.
- Assembly: Bolts are passed through the clip's holes and the underlying support structure (like ties or base plates).
- Securing: Nuts are run down the bolts, often with washers to distribute pressure, and then tightened securely to compress the clip against the rail and the support.
- Adjustment: Some systems use a cam for lateral adjustment, while others use slots in the clip to allow for minor movement before final tightening.
- Tightening: Nuts are tightened to the required torque specified by the manufacturer to ensure the clip has a firm, stable hold.

Welded clips
- Placement: The clip is positioned on the base of the rail.
- Weld preparation: The clip's base is prepared for welding.
- Welding: A fillet weld is applied around the clip's base, securing it to the supporting structure.
- Tightening: For certain designs with a self-tightening mechanism, nuts are tightened to a specified torque after welding to apply a controlled force to the rail.

Process procedures of rail clips
The complete process procedures of rail clips include:
- Raw material purchasing
- Shearing
- Heating to forging temperature
- Forming
- Hardening
- Tempering
- Surface treatment
- Inspection-Packing
